Least Common Multiple of 3603 and 3604 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 3603 and 3604,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(3603,3604) = 1
LCM(3603,3604) = ( 3603 × 3604) / 1
LCM(3603,3604) = 12985212 / 1
LCM(3603,3604) = 12985212
